High-resolution Givetian-Frasnian boundary recognition from conodont-chemo-stratigraphic correlation at Liujing, Guangxi, South China
Authors:Dayong Jiang  Weicheng Hao  Gan Ding  Shunliang Bai
Affiliation:(1) Department of Geology, Peking University, 100871 Beijing, China
Abstract:The Givetian-Frasnian boundary at Liujing, Guangxi, South China is for the first time recognized and correlated in high resolution using characteristic chemocycles of element abundance fluctuation integrated with conodont biostratignphy. The first appearance of Ancyrodella rotundiloba early form is as a biomarker, and the boundary of lowering fluctuation of element abundance followed by a sequence of characteristic chemocycles with a sequence of cmodonts is as an abiotic auxiliary marker. The error is not more than 0.10 Ma. The study indicates that in a quiet interval, characteristic chemocycles integrated with biomarkers can be used for boundary recognition and regional cormlation in high resolution, and this method has potential for intercontinental correlation
